حديث 594·الباب 68 · باب الورَع وترك الشبهات·رياض الصالحين · Riyad Al Salihin

عَنْ عائشةَ رَضِيَ اللهُ عَنْهُا قالتْ: كانَ لأبي بَكْرٍ الصَّدِّيقِ رَضِيَ اللهُ عَنْهُ غُلامٌ يُخْرِجُ لَهُ الخَرَاجَ، وكانَ أَبو بَكْرٍ رَضِيَ اللهُ عَنْهُ يَأْكُلُ مِنْ خَرَاجِهِ، فَجَاءَ يَومًا بِشَيءٍ، فَأَكَلَ مِنْهُ أَبُو بَكْرٍ، فَقَالَ لَهُ الغُلامُ: تَدْرِي مَا هَذا؟ فَقَالَ أَبُو بَكْرٍ: ومَا هُوَ؟ فَقَالَ: كُنْتُ تَكَهَّنْتُ لإِنْسَانٍ في الجاهِلِيَّةِ، ومَا أُحْسِنُ الكَهَانَةَ إِلَّا أَنِّي خَدَعْتُهُ، فَلَقِيَنِي، فَأَعْطَاني بِذلكَ هَذَا الَّذي أَكَلْتَ مِنْهُ، فَأَدْخَلَ أَبُو بَكْرٍ يَدَهُ فَقَاءَ كُلَّ شَيءٍ في بَطْنِهِ، رَوَاهُ الْبُخَارِيّ.

A'ishah (may Allah be pleased with her) reported: Abu Bakr al-Siddiq (may Allah be pleased with him) had a servant who would bring him a portion of his earnings, and Abu Bakr (may Allah be pleased with him) used to eat from what he brought. One day the servant brought him something, and Abu Bakr ate from it. The servant then said to him: "Do you know what this is?" Abu Bakr asked: "What is it?" He replied: "In the time of ignorance I once posed as a soothsayer for a man, though I knew nothing of soothsaying and merely deceived him. He met me later and gave me, in return for that, this from which you have just eaten." So Abu Bakr put his hand into his mouth and vomited up everything in his stomach. Reported by al-Bukhari.

الشرح · explanation

يخرج له الخراج: أي يأتيه بما يكسبه. الخَراجُ: شَيءٌ يَجْعَلُهُ السَّيِّدُ عَلى عَبْدِهِ، يُؤدِّيهِ إلى السيِّدِ كُلَّ يَومٍ، وَبَاقي كَسْبِهِ يَكُونُ للعَبْدِ. تكهّنتُ: من الكهانة وهي الإخبار عما سيكون في المستقبل من غير دليل شرعي. فقاء: أي أخرج بالقيء واستفرغ ما في بطنه.

Would bring him a portion of his earnings (al-kharaj): that is, he would bring him what he earned. Al-kharaj: something a master imposes upon his slave, which the slave pays to the master each day, while the remainder of his earnings belongs to the slave. I posed as a soothsayer (takahhantu): from kahanah (soothsaying), which is to foretell what will happen in the future without any legitimate basis in the Sacred Law. Vomited up: that is, he expelled by vomiting and emptied what was in his stomach.

الدروس · lessons

فضل أبي بكر الصديق رضي الله عنه وورعه وتنزهه عن أن يدخل جوفه شيء فيه أدنى شبهة، مع أنه لا يلزمه ذلك شرعّا. مشروعية إخبار أهل الورع بتفاصيل بعض الأمور التي قد يتورع عنها. بطلان الكهانة، وحرمتها، وحرمة كسبها.

The excellence of Abu Bakr al-Siddiq (may Allah be pleased with him), his scrupulousness, and his keeping himself far from letting anything containing the slightest doubt enter his body, even though he was not religiously obliged to do so. It is permissible to inform the scrupulous of the details of certain matters from which they may wish to abstain. The falsehood of soothsaying, its prohibition, and the prohibition of earning a living through it.
